Waukesha utility approves $407,708 contract to replace water main on Bidwell and Prospect

City of Waukesha Water Utility Commission · February 19, 2026

Summary

The City of Waukesha Water Utility Commission approved a $407,708.18 contract for replacement of roughly 1,400 feet of 8‑inch water main on Bidwell and Prospect. The low construction bid was reported at $403,671.47; the commission approved the utility portion plus a 1% city administration fee by voice vote.

The City of Waukesha Water Utility Commission approved a contract to replace approximately 1,400 feet of 8‑inch water main on Bidwell and Prospect, the commission heard Feb. 19.

Staff said six bids were opened January 23 and the low bid for the utility work came from Wandel (Wandell) Contractors at $403,671.47.
